Every support gem has a category of INT/DEX/STR. Every time you assign one to a skill, it increases your dependency on that stat by +5, or one attribute node on the skill tree. At the bottom of the Skills window, there should be a capacity displayed for your current stats as to what you can handle on your character at this point in time. If these numbers are ever displayed in red, you have a problem with your support gems.
Since you are equipping an Astramantis just to equip your support gems, you are likely tricking yourself into believing that some of those supports are active, when they really aren't. If at any point you go below this attribute requirement while already equipped, certain skills can fail to function, be marked with (!) as invalid, or fail to be recognized by the in-game stats.
